Christmas Progressive Dinners!!!

We've got a great Christmas Party lined up for December 14th for both middle and high school students. We are planning a Progressive Dinner (everyone travels to different houses... eating a different course of the meal as they go). At the final homes, each ministry will have a $5 gift exchange.

It will be a total blast. Now, I'm just waiting to see who has the best lineup of food before I decide where I'm going... hehe...

Frontline (High School) will be visiting these families:
-Morton/Hutto (appetizer)
-Brooks (main course... spaghetti and breadsticks)
-Reffett (dessert and gift exchange)

Underground (Middle School) will be visiting these families:
-Cerezo (appetizer)
-Galloway (main course)
-Alfred (dessert... brownie sundaes... mmmmmm...)

Student are signing up for the Progressive Dinners right now. It starts at 6 pm and concludes at 9:30 pm and costs just $10!!! That's a pretty good deal...

5 Best Things to Say When Caught Sleeping at Desk...

This week is going to be a long week with lots of school projects to finish up as the semester draws to a close... I might need a couple of these. I found this HERE.

5 Best Things to Say When Caught Sleeping at Your Desk:
submitted by Liz Kroll

5. "They told me at the Blood Bank this might happen."

4. "This is just a 15 minute power nap they raved about in the time management course you sent me to."

3. "Whew! Guess I left the top off the Whiteout. You probably got here just in time."

2. "Did you ever notice sound coming out of these keyboards when you put your ear down real close?" And the NUMBER ONE best thing to say if you get caught sleeping at your desk...

1. Raise your head slowly and say, "...in Jesus' name, Amen."
